organizational and economic provision


It is always a problem when students ask to help them translate the titles of their graduation theses in English.
Does the following sound OK?
'Organizational and economic provision for the stimulation of innovative activity of an enterprise’s/business entity’s staff.
The idea is to describe all organizational and economic activities, tools, strategies, you name it to stimulate the employees of an enterprise/business entity to get interested in innovation.

Thank you in advance.

Tools and Strategies to Encourage Employee Creativity

Thank you very much.